Voyager's route through the Delta Quadrant is tracked by Voth scientist Dr Gegen, with Hanon IV and the Nekrit Supply Depot among the locations ([#42 and #43 Basics] and [#55 Fair Trade] respectively). Gegen is in search of evidence about the true origins of his race who are a saurian species that he suspects evolved in a distant part of the galaxy, although the distant origin theory contradicts the doctrine of the powerful Voth elders. Gegen and his assistant Veer eventually find and board Voyager, at first undetected but then Voyager's sensors disclose the use of the Voth cloaking technology and the crew find Gegen and Veer. Gegen manages to escape, transporting back to his vessel with the unconscious Chakotay. Separately, the Doctor and Gegen discover that the Voth evolved from Earth's dinosaurs, avoided extinction, developed spacefaring technology and left Earth. When Gegen is charged with heresy by the Voth elders, Chakotay is the living proof of Gegen's theories. But before he can take Chakotay to his supporters, Voyager is transported inside a massive Voth city-ship and the crew detained. Defiantly Gegen agrees to face heresy charges, but retracts his theory when the Voth chairing the hearing threatens to destroy Voyager and send the crew to a detention colony.

EQUIPMENT AND SUPPLIES

Starfleet uniforms contain a microscopic identification code indicating the name of the ship the crewman is stationed on.
